Description
2-(4-Bromophenoxy)acetic acid (CAS No. 1878-91-7) is a high-purity brominated aromatic compound with the molecular formula C8H7BrO3. This white to off-white crystalline powder is a versatile intermediate in organic synthesis, particularly in the preparation of phenoxy herbicides and pharmaceutical building blocks. With a molecular weight of 231.05 g/mol, it offers excellent reactivity for nucleophilic substitution and coupling reactions. Our product is rigorously tested to ensure ≥98% purity (HPLC) and is supplied in amber glass bottles under inert atmosphere to prevent degradation. Ideal for researchers in agrochemical and medicinal chemistry, this compound is characterized by 1H NMR, 13C NMR, and FT-IR spectroscopy for batch-to-batch consistency. Store at 2-8°C in a dry environment.

Application
2-(4-Bromophenoxy)acetic acid serves as a key precursor in synthetic organic chemistry, particularly for developing plant growth regulators analogous to auxin hormones. Researchers utilize this compound to create novel phenoxy herbicide derivatives with enhanced selectivity. In pharmaceutical applications, it acts as a scaffold for designing COX-2 inhibitors and other bioactive molecules. The bromine moiety enables further functionalization via palladium-catalyzed cross-coupling reactions.
Safety and Hazards
GHS Hazard Statements
- H315 (100%): Causes skin irritation [Warning Skin corrosion/irritation]
- H319 (100%): Causes serious eye irritation [Warning Serious eye damage/eye irritation]
- H335 (100%): May cause respiratory irritation [Warning Specific target organ toxicity, single exposure; Respiratory tract irritation]
Precautionary Statements
- P261, P264, P264+P265, P271, P280, P302+P352, P304+P340, P305+P351+P338, P319, P321, P332+P317, P337+P317, P362+P364, P403+P233, P405, and P501
Hazard Classes and Categories
- Skin Irrit. 2 (100%)
- Eye Irrit. 2A (100%)
- STOT SE 3 (100%)
